数据库多语言实现是指在一个数据库系统中支持多种语言的数据存储和检索。这通常涉及到国际化(i18n)和本地化(l10n)的需求,使得应用程序能够根据用户的语言偏好显示相应的内容。
原因:为每种语言创建独立的字段或表会导致数据冗余,增加存储和维护成本。
解决方法:
locale
表来存储不同语言的翻译。原因:多语言查询可能导致复杂的SQL查询,影响数据库性能。
解决方法:
原因:多语言数据更新时容易出现不一致的情况。
解决方法:
通过以上方法,可以有效地实现数据库的多语言支持,提升应用程序的国际化水平。
小程序·云开发官方直播课(数据库方向)
云+社区沙龙online[数据工匠]
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
北极星训练营
Tendis系列直播
云原生正发声
云+社区沙龙online [技术应变力]
云+社区沙龙online第5期[架构演进]
领取专属 10元无门槛券
手把手带您无忧上云